Asbury Automotive Group, Inc. (NYSE:ABG) acquired Terry Lee Honda from Terry Lee Companies, Inc. on January 8, 2018. Post transaction, Terry Lee Honda will be renamed as Hare Honda. Geoffrey Grodner and Dustin Plummer of Mallor Grodner LLP acted as the legal advisor and Brodie Cobb of Presidio Merchant Partners LLC acted as the financial advisor to Terry Lee Companies, Inc. whereas Kevin Sutton and Katherine Frazier of Hill Ward & Henderson acted as the legal advisor to Asbury Automotive Group, Inc. on the transaction.
Asbury Automotive Group, Inc. (NYSE:ABG) completed the acquisition of Terry Lee Honda from Terry Lee Companies, Inc. on January 8, 2018.
Asbury Automotive Group, Inc. is an automotive retailer company. The Company operates through two segments: Dealerships and Total Care Auto (TCA). The Company offers a range of automotive products and services, including new and used vehicles; parts and service, which includes vehicle repair and maintenance services, replacement parts and collision repair services, and finance and insurance (F&I) products, which includes arranging vehicle financing through third parties and aftermarket products, such as extended service contracts, guaranteed asset protection (GAP) debt cancellation and prepaid maintenance. The Company operates approximately 160 new vehicle dealerships, consisting of 208 franchises, representing 31 domestic and foreign brands of vehicles. Its TCA, powered by Landcar, is a provider of service contracts and other vehicle protection products, and 37 collision repair centers.
